ACPA Ambassadors 

The ACPA Ambassadors will provide a personal link between ACPA and campuses worldwide. Ambassadors are pro-active individuals seeking an opportunity to become actively engaged with their professional association and who have committed to sharing professional development and leadership opportunities with their local colleagues. Ambassadors keep professionals at their institutions informed regarding ACPA/SCGSNP events and programs, encourage membership in ACPA and the SCGSNP, and provide feedback to the association and its leadership. 

Participants will have many opportunities to serve ACPA while gaining valuable networking, leadership, and career development. The Ambassador position will provide specifically focused engagement for master’s students, doctoral students, and new professionals.   

Benefits:      
       Direct voice to ACPA leadership to share thoughts, ideas, and concerns          
       Opportunity to shape the future of ACPA by providing immediate and direct feedback
       Participation in a mentor program involving ACPA Leadership and prominent Student Affairs professionals
       Free participation in specific intentionally focused professional development opportunities offered at least quarterly     
       ACPA Ambassadors recognition pin          
       Appreciation and networking reception during convention with ACPA Leadership* 
        Recognition on ACPA website and in convention publications        
       Nametag identification at Convention to be clearly visible and distinguished in role*
Requirements:        
       Must intend to be at their current institution through March 2013        
       Must maintain active membership in ACPA        
       Commit to the position for duration of one year (inaugural position will be held from February 2012 March 2013)        
       A maximum of one Ambassador will be selected per institution in each category:
     Ø  Graduate Student- Master’s or Doctoral   
Ø  New Professional

Responsibilities:                 

All Ambassadors        
       Participate in regular conference calls with Ambassadors and ACPA leadership        
       Serve as focus group for new ACPA initiatives and programs        
       Serve on one ACPA or SCGSNP committee        
       Communicate and promote ACPA updates to institution at least monthly        
       Contribute one article to the SCGSNP newsletter         
       Utilize social media to promote ACPA and SCGSNP including Facebook and Twitter        
       Assist at special events during convention including those held in the leadership suites*  ·       
       Participate in SCGSNP leadership meetings during convention*(Convention attendance is not mandatory for Ambassadors; however, these and other opportunities will be available for Ambassadors that are able to attend Convention 2012.)
Graduate Student Ambassadors (in addition to those listed under All Ambassadors)        
       Serve as an official ACPA representative for student affairs student organizations on campus (as applicable)        
       Assist in the development of student affairs student organizations at host institution and at institutions where one is not currently in place

New Professional Ambassadors (in addition to those listed under All Ambassadors)        
       Aid in promoting Phyllis Mabel New Professional Institute        
       Facilitate one ACPA networking event or program on the campus, state, or regional level each semester.
